giblet, giblets
edible viscera of a fowl
-
offal
viscera and trimmings of a butchered animal often considered inedible by humans
-
heart
a firm rather dry variety meat (usually beef or veal)
-
liver
liver of an animal used as meat
-
sweetbread, sweetbreads
edible glands of an animal
-
brain
the brain of certain animals used as meat
-
stomach sweetbread
edible pancreas of an animal
-
neck sweetbread, throat sweetbread
edible thymus gland of an animal
-
tongue
the tongue of certain animals used as meat
-
tripe
lining of the stomach of a ruminant (especially a bovine) used as food
-
chitlings, chitlins, chitterlings
small intestines of hogs prepared as food
-
haslet
heart and liver and other edible viscera especially of hogs; usually chopped and formed into a loaf and braised
-
calf's liver, calves' liver
liver of a calf used as meat
-
chicken liver
liver of a chicken used as meat
-
goose liver
liver of a goose used as meat
-
calf's brain
the brain of a calf eaten as meat
-
beef tongue
the tongue of a cow eaten as meat
-
calf's tongue
the tongue of a calf eaten as meat
-
honeycomb tripe
lining of the reticulum (or second stomach) of a ruminant used as food
-
tomalley
edible greenish substance in boiled lobster
